Top Storyline: The Clash of Offensive Mastery vs. Defensive Tenacity
- Can the Wolves’ defense withstand the Nuggets’ potent offense led by Nikola Jokic?
- Matchups to watch: Gobert vs. Jokic, Conley vs. Murray, McDaniels vs. Porter Jr.
- The Wolves’ defensive strategy and the Nuggets’ cohesive chemistry are set to collide in a battle for supremacy.

Key Matchup: Gobert vs. Jokic
- A showdown between two titans: Jokic’s offensive prowess vs. Gobert’s defensive prowess.
- Jokic’s ability to navigate Gobert’s defense will be crucial for the Nuggets’ success.
Key Players to Watch:
- For Nuggets: Michael Porter Jr.’s resurgence after personal challenges and his impact on the series.
- For Timberwolves: Anthony Edwards’ emergence as a playoff force and his matchup against Jokic.
Key Statistic: Offensive Dominance vs. Defensive Grit
- The Wolves’ offensive explosion in the first round, scoring 123.2 points per 100 possessions, showcases their offensive prowess.
- Nuggets’ defensive rebounding and ability to limit Wolves’ shooting opportunities will be critical factors in the series.
